Playing for Change
Stand By Me
Four years ago while walking down the street in Santa Monica, CA the Playing For Change crew heard Roger Ridley singing “Stand By Me” from a block away. His voice, soul and passion set the crew on a journey around the world to add other musicians to his performance.
This song transformed Playing For Change from a small group of individuals into a global movement for peace and understanding.
Taken from the award-winning documentary, "Playing For Change: Peace Through Music", this track, a cover of the Ben E. King classic, features over 35 musicians collaborating from all over the world; they may have never met in person, but in this case, the music does the talking.
The Inspiration
Playing for Change is a multimedia movement created to inspire, connect, and bring peace to the world through music.
The idea for this project arose from a common belief that music has the power to break down boundaries and overcome distances between people.
No matter whether people come from different geographic, political, economic, spiritual or ideological backgrounds, music has the universal power to transcend and unite us as one human race.
And with this truth firmly fixed in the minds of those who initiated it, they set out to share it with the world.
